1

10 Signs To Watch For To Get A New Local SEO Agency Near Me

News Discuss 
Why It Is Important To Hire An Experienced SEO Company For Your Business SEO is a vital element of any online business. A local London SEO firm can help you improve the search engine rankings of your website and increase organic traffic. A London SEO agency can offer SEO technical https://localseoexpertnearme39962.eveowiki.com/100727/10_locations_where_you_can_find_seo_services_near_me

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story